Children from Newport have been introduced to the world of work through a partnership between Business in the Community (BITC) and Wales & West Utilities. Fifty pupils from Gaer Primary School spent a day testing their creative, marketing and sales skills as part of an enterprise challenge which saw a dozen Wales & West Utilities volunteers support and guide independent and group thinking. As part of the event, teams competed to develop businesses making and selling paper hopping frogs. They spent time working together to come up with a business name before designing a logo and buying the resources to allow them to get their businesses off
the ground. The challenge focussed on helping the year 6 pupils to recognise the various contributions individuals can make to a team effort. Nigel Winnan, Wales & West Utilities Customer & Social Obligations Manager, helped lead the day and said: “We were delighted to spend time with Gaer Primary pupils, introducing them to the world of work. All got a great deal out of the event, which helped them learn how to approach different tasks and the various skills needed to make a business a success. “The event was a fun day but had a serious message. It was a great way of
increasing pupil’s awareness of
the skills and attitudes needed in the workplace.”
